On October 10, 2025, Aramark announced a new multi‑year agreement with the University of Pennsylvania Health System (UPHS) to provide patient and retail food, environmental services, patient transportation, and an integrated call center across UPHS’s 4,000‑bed, seven‑hospital system. The contract will begin in early 2026 and represents Aramark’s largest U.S. deal to date, the second largest in company history. The partnership will leverage Aramark’s AI‑driven patient menu platform, robotic environmental services, and AIWX staffing platform to streamline operations.
The deal expands Aramark’s footprint in the high‑margin healthcare services segment, adding a significant new revenue stream that is expected to contribute to the company’s 4‑5% net new growth target for fiscal 2025. By integrating advanced technology such as AI‑powered menu configuration and mobile ordering, Aramark aims to enhance patient experience and operational efficiency across the UPHS system. The contract also positions Aramark to capture a larger share of the growing market for integrated healthcare support services.
